I've been using it for temp shots right now, which means it's more
forgiving and I don't need to do the cleanup to such an extent on the 5-15%
of it that glitches out. But I'm just using it in a pretty vanilla way, no
secret methodology as far as I know.  With VectorDistort, I've been setting
the frame distance to zero. I've been tracking stuff to faces that have had
a lot of movement, without going too "off model". Also tracking flames to
moving bodies. In that situation, I have to account for the flames going
beyond the edges of the person, but sometimes just blurring or offsetting
the UV map (baked out) is enough to get me over the line.

Converting SmartVectors to motion vectors is nice too.
